What is an Upwork Cover Letter?
An Upwork cover letter is your first impression on a potential client. It’s a concise, personalized message you send along with your proposal when applying for jobs on the Upwork platform. Think of it as your digital handshake, designed to capture the client’s attention and convince them that you’re the perfect fit for their project. It’s more than just a formality; it’s a crucial tool for showcasing your skills, experience, and understanding of the client’s needs. A well-crafted cover letter can be the difference between landing your dream job and getting lost in the sea of other applicants. Therefore, it’s essential to invest time and effort in creating compelling cover letters that highlight your strengths and demonstrate your value proposition.
Why Is an Upwork Cover Letter Important?
The importance of an Upwork cover letter cannot be overstated. In a competitive freelance environment, where clients are often bombarded with proposals, your cover letter serves as your primary marketing tool. It’s your chance to stand out from the crowd and make a lasting impression. A compelling cover letter demonstrates professionalism, attention to detail, and a genuine interest in the project. It allows you to go beyond the basic information in your Upwork profile and directly address the client’s specific needs. By highlighting your relevant skills, experience, and accomplishments, you can quickly establish your credibility and build trust with the client. Furthermore, a well-written cover letter shows that you’ve taken the time to understand the project requirements and are committed to delivering high-quality work.
Top 5 Secrets to Writing an Upwork Cover Letter That Wins

Crafting a winning Upwork cover letter requires more than just listing your skills; it demands a strategic approach. Here are five secrets to help you create cover letters that grab clients’ attention and increase your chances of getting hired. These secrets emphasize personalization, showcasing relevant experience, and providing a clear call to action, all designed to make your proposal stand out. By incorporating these elements, you can transform your cover letters from generic applications into persuasive pitches that resonate with clients and demonstrate your value.
Highlight Relevant Skills
One of the most effective strategies is to highlight the skills that directly align with the job requirements. Carefully read the job description and identify the key skills the client is looking for. Then, in your cover letter, explicitly mention how your skills and experience match their needs. Use specific examples to illustrate how you’ve successfully applied these skills in past projects. Quantify your achievements whenever possible; for instance, instead of saying you’re a good writer, state that you increased a client’s website traffic by a certain percentage with your content. This approach demonstrates that you understand the client’s needs and can deliver results. Tailoring your skills to the project requirements is crucial for showing that you’re the right person for the job.
Demonstrate Understanding of the Project
Clients want to know that you’ve taken the time to understand their project. Show that you’ve carefully reviewed the job description and that you grasp the project’s objectives and the client’s expectations. Briefly summarize the project’s goals in your own words to demonstrate your comprehension. If possible, offer a specific idea or suggestion related to the project. This shows initiative and a proactive approach. By demonstrating your understanding, you signal to the client that you’re not just applying for a job; you’re genuinely interested in helping them achieve their goals. This level of engagement sets you apart from applicants who send generic cover letters.
Showcase Your Past Achievements

Instead of simply listing your skills, use your cover letter to showcase your past achievements. Provide concrete examples of how you’ve successfully completed similar projects. Quantify your results whenever possible, using metrics such as increased sales, improved website traffic, or reduced costs. This provides clients with tangible evidence of your capabilities and the value you can bring to their project. For instance, if you’re a writer, mention a project where your content generated a certain number of leads. If you’re a developer, highlight a project where you delivered the solution on time and under budget. Showcase your successes to give clients a clear idea of what to expect when they hire you.
Personalize Your Cover Letter
Generic cover letters are easily dismissed. Personalize each cover letter to demonstrate that you’ve read the job description and understand the client’s needs. Address the client by name if possible, and avoid using templates that make your application seem impersonal. Show genuine interest in the project and briefly explain why you’re excited about it. This can be as simple as mentioning something that particularly interests you about the project or the client’s business. Personalizing your cover letter shows that you’re taking the time to connect with the client, making a positive impact and increases your chances of standing out.
Include a Clear Call to Action
Don’t leave the client wondering what to do next. Include a clear call to action at the end of your cover letter. This might be as simple as asking for an interview or suggesting a time to discuss the project further. Make it easy for the client to take the next step. Ensure your call to action is relevant to the project and aligns with the client’s needs. A well-placed call to action prompts the client to take immediate action, which can significantly increase your chances of getting hired. This action helps to convert interest into a meeting or a project start.
Upwork Cover Letter Examples

To illustrate the principles, here are examples of cover letters for different freelance roles. These examples highlight how to incorporate the five secrets to win clients. These should serve as a good starting point for creating your own cover letters and allow you to modify to fit your needs.
Example Cover Letter for a Freelance Writer
Dear [Client Name],
I am writing to express my interest in the freelance writing position you posted on Upwork. I have been a freelance writer for [Number] years, and I am confident that I have the skills and experience necessary to create compelling content for your project. I was particularly excited to see that you are looking for someone to write [type of content], as my experience includes [mention specific experience related to the job]. In my previous role with [Previous client name], I wrote [type of content], and was able to increase their website traffic by [percentage]. My understanding is that you need [project goal] and I can help with that. I am proficient in SEO, and I am well-versed in writing content for various audiences. I would be thrilled to work with you on this project. Please feel free to reach out with any questions. I am available for a call at your convenience.
Sincerely, [Your Name]
Example Cover Letter for a Web Developer
Dear [Client Name],
I am writing to express my strong interest in the web development project described in your Upwork job posting. I am a highly skilled web developer with [Number] years of experience in building and maintaining websites using [mention languages/frameworks]. I was particularly drawn to your project’s focus on [mention specific technologies or features of the job]. Based on the description, my knowledge of [relevant skills] will be the best solution for your project. In my previous role with [Previous client name], I developed a website from scratch, which increased user engagement by [percentage]. I understand that you need [project goal] and I can certainly help you with that. I am confident that I can deliver a high-quality website that meets your exact specifications and goals. I am available for a call to discuss the project at your earliest convenience.
Sincerely, [Your Name]
Key Takeaways and Next Steps

Writing an effective Upwork cover letter is essential for attracting clients and securing freelance jobs. Remember to highlight relevant skills, demonstrate your understanding of the project, showcase your past achievements, personalize your cover letters, and include a clear call to action. By implementing these strategies, you can significantly increase your chances of standing out from the competition and winning new clients on Upwork. Take the time to tailor each cover letter to the specific job and client. Review your cover letters for clarity, grammar, and overall appeal. Also, make sure your Upwork profile is up to date and showcases your best work. By taking these steps, you can create compelling cover letters that impress clients and convert applications into successful collaborations.
